Ready to conquer the streets and quietly zoom by. During MASTERS EXPO, Renault will reveal the new 5 E-Tech electric, a car that symbolizes the 'Renaulution'. This compact electric pop icon is not only a tribute to the past, but also an example of technological innovation and sustainable production.

The new Renault 5 E-Tech electric represents the strategic course of Renault Group towards a greener future. The car retains the charm of the previous model, but is packed with the latest electric and digital gadgets. In doing so, the company has not only used its own know-how, but also that of Ampere – the part of Renault Group that specializes in the development of electric vehicles and software.

Luca de Meo, CEO of Renault Group, explains that the new addition will bring lasting change: “The Renault 5 E-Tech electric is unlike any other car. It not only supports the transition to electric, connected mobility – as part of a greener, more sustainable approach – but also plays a key role in Renault Group’s transformation into a next-generation carmaker. Developing the car to such a technological level in France in just three years required us to take extraordinary decisions and be as agile as possible in our organisation.”

“For this project, we reversed our normal approach. We used AmpR Small, our new EV platform that is unique in Europe. This allowed us to reduce costs across the value chain to maintain profitability while delivering the very best in EV and digital technology. At the same time, we also shifted our industrial ecosystem… It takes an iconic car to get everyone working together like this and to pave the way for lasting changes in our internal organization. Our industry is going through major changes, but I believe this car will open new paths for Renault.”

Nod to the past

When the French carmaker introduced it in 1972, the Renault 5 stood out with its original and modern design. The shield bumpers and bright body colours and the shape of the headlights gave the car a mischievous, almost human look. The Renault 5 reflected the changing society of the time and became an instant hit – especially with women and young people, a new group of buyers at the time. 

But how do you give such a timeless icon a new impulse, fitting in with the modern, electric and digital world? That was the challenge for the design team.

A 'retro-futuristic' style was chosen: bold headlights, striking colours, and playful details such as vertical rear lights and a new ventilation grille in the shape of the number 5 that lights up when you approach the car. The Renault 5 E-Tech electric nods to the past, but with subtle aerodynamic tweaks that make it fully ready for the 21st century. So it impresses again, now as an electric icon with a touch of nostalgia.
